(A) The $ABO$ blood grouping system is based on the presence or absence of two surface antigens on the red blood cells ($A$ and $B$).
$1$. Individuals with blood group $A$ have antigen $A$ on their RBCs and antibody $b$ (anti-$B$) in their plasma.
$2$. Individuals with blood group $B$ have antigen $B$ on their RBCs and antibody $a$ (anti-$A$) in their plasma.
$3$. Individuals with blood group $AB$ have both antigens $A$ and $B$ on their RBCs and no antibodies $(nil)$ in their plasma.
$4$. Individuals with blood group $O$ have no antigens on their RBCs and both antibodies $a$ and $b$ (anti-$A$ and anti-$B$) in their plasma.
